We’ll walk the field and collect petrified wood (cypress), probably originally deposited in the Cretaceous or Paleocene Rancocas Group and later redeposited in a Pleistocene bed. (Thanks to Dr. Earl Manning, DVPS member, for correcting our previous description of the petrified wood as being Pleistocene.) No special equipment is necessary; in fact, you should leave your tools at home so that we do not do anything to cause erosion on this low-till farm.
